A. already B. concerned C. enhance D. focused E. hardly
F. highlighted G. intensify H. particular I. practical J. priority
K. shortages L. surpluses M. surveyed N. technical O. workforce
Employers fear they will be unable to recruit students with the skills they need as the economic recovery kicks in, a new survey reveals. Nearly half of the organisations told researchers they were 【C1】______ struggling to find staff with skills in science, technology, engineering and maths (STEM), while even more companies expect to experience 【C2】______ of employees with STEM skills in the next three years.
The Confederation of British Industry 【C3】______ 694 businesses and organisations across the public and private sectors, which together employ 2.4 million people. Half are 【C4】______ they will not be able to fill graduate posts in the coming years, while a third said they would not be able to recruit enough employees with the right A-level skills. "As we move further into recovery and busi nesses plan for growth, the demand for people with high-quality skills and qualifications will 【C5】______," said Richard Lambert, Director General, CBI. "Firms say it is already hard to find people with the right 【C6】______ or engineering skills. The new government must make it a top 【C7】______ to encourage more young people to study science-related subjects." The survey found that young people would improve their job prospects if they studied business, maths, English and physics or chemistry at A-level. The A-levels that employers rate least are psychology and sociology. And while many employers don’t insist on a 【C8】______ degree subject, a third prefer to hire those with a STEM-related subject.
The research 【C9】______ worries about the lack of progress in improving basic skills in the UK 【C10】______. Half of the employers expressed worries about employees’ basic literacy and numeracy (计算)skills, while the biggest problem is with IT skills, where two-thirds reported concerns. [br] 【C4】
选项
答案
B
解析
空格前are和空格后的从句提示,此处可填入形容词作表语,也可填入动词分词,构成进行时或被动语态。空格所在从句意为“未来几年招不到足够的毕业生,以填补职位空缺”,由此可知此处描述用人单位对未来不乐观形势的“担忧”,词库中concerned“担心的”符合语义,故选B。
